Sealant Strips

Sealant strips and draft excluders can keep air from running out the doors. Draft excluders can be placed under a door to stop warm air from escaping and cool air from entering your home. Sealant strips fit around the door frames. You can purchase these at your local hardware store.

Almost all supplies that are used in projects concerning home improvements might tempt a thief. You should be sure to secure them when you are not being used. If the home is secure you can leave them inside. If you are unable to secure your materials in the structure, consider a storage container or unit that can be locked.

Connecting PVC pipes is easy and only requires you to use PVC primer and cement. Make sure that the products you use fit your pipes. Also you don’t want the surface of your pipes to be wet.

One of the major expenses for a homeowner is replacing a roof. Solicit price quotes from no less than three contractors and make sure you have verified their references. There are a lot of choices available for roofing, from metal to lightweight tile, although there are still the traditional choices like composite shingles and wood shake. A good contractor that does roofing will assist you in deciding what to get.

One of the most commonly overlooked considerations for home improvement projects is finding an appropriate way to dispose of unwanted debris. Before you begin your project, designate a particular spot to hold the debris and garbage until you can have it removed.
